OVERVIEWIt’s a fact that personality style has a significant impact on how people approach work and prefer to interact with others. Wouldn’t your professional life be less stressful if you knew a simple way to reach accurate conclusions about your co-workers’ personality styles and could use that information to communicate most effectively to get the results you need? That’s exactly what you’ll learn how to do in People-Reading Made Easy: A Simple Framework for Building Effective Workplace Relationships!WHY SHOULD YOU ATTENDWhether you’re a manager, HR professional or employee at any level, chances are that much of the stress you experience at work is related to ‘people’ issues – and these issues often result from basic personality differences. Chances are that you work with people of varying personality styles – some similar to you and some quite different, so treating people the way you want to be treated doesn’t always bring about positive results.AREAS COVERED• How and why learning how to identify DiSC (Dominance, Influence, Steadiness and Conscientiousness) styles through people reading can help you build effective workplace relationships• Mastering a basic 2-question framework that identify your own general DISC style and • Applying the same 2-question framework to reading the general DISC style of other people • Getting a sense of how DISC style manifests in a person’s personality and impacts interactions with others • Developing an understanding of the priorities, fears, motivations and challenges specific to each DISC style • How to apply knowledge about a person’s DISC style to improve relationships and achieve results • Guidance on how to explore DISC more thoroughly to achieve specific workplace objectives, such as identifying your precise style, building relationships in the workplace, improving management skills, growing as a leader, developing a leader's framework for decision making, and more. LEARNING OBJECTIVESThis informative session provides you with two simple questions that will allow you to determine where the personality styles of your coworkers and employees fall within the four broad behavioral styles using the industry-standard Everything DiSC (Dominance, Influence, Steadiness and Conscientiousness) model.
